Hello and welcome to Eurosport's LIVE text commentary of the Premier League clash between Brighton and Tottenham. Well, this will be an interesting one. Coming into the game off the back of THAT 7-2 thrashing at the hands of German champions Bayern Munich, Mauricio Pochettino simply must get a response from his fragile players. Spurs haven't won on the road in the league since January - now would be a reasonably good time to do just that.

One change for Brighton from their 2-0 defeat at Chelsea last weekend, with Aaron Connolly handed a first league start, replacing Yves Bissouma.

Pochettino makes FOUR changes from the side humiliated by Bayern Munich in midweek, but Toby Alderweireld and Jan Vertonghen keep their places at centre-back, Ben Davies replaces the suspended Serge Aurier. It looks like Moussa Sissoko will play at right back. Eric Dier, Erik Lamela and Christian Eriksen also come in, with Danny Rose, Harry Winks and Dele Alli dropping to the bench.
